This book is a complete guide to the development and successful implementation of inductive power transfer, a technology that enables the power supply of devices without physical contact. Beginning with the theoretical underpinnings of the subject, the author analyses the principles of working, design, and implementation of inductive power transfer systems. The book's insightful treatment extends to both dynamic charging and static charging, and presents essential comparison with existing power transfer technologies, making it a comprehensive treatment of a burgeoning field. Additionally, it delivers practical and valuable know-how from real-world applications, expanding the reader's perspective and understanding. By contextualizing inductive power transfer within the broader realm of power electronics, the author demonstrates its application in diverse fields such as transportation, automation, and medical devices, providing valuable insights to engineers and researchers in these areas.
